Quebec ponders moving MGH to Glen
The original plans for the Glen superhospital involved moving the Montreal General and the Neuro to the Glen site. This idea was abandoned (this piece reminds us, at a time when François Legault was PQ health minister) but now is in play again because the projected cost of renovating the existing General has skyrocketed.
